City Homes opens models at Tranquility

City Homes has come back to Bowmanville!  Their newest community, Tranquility, features 12 brand new designs on 40’ lots.  Stunning, decorated and furnished model homes are now open to provide a taste of what living in a City Home could be like.
            You can now visit the website at www.mycityhome.ca to watch a virtual tour of the models.
            Starting in the mid-$200s, these bungalow and two-storey homes come with a wide array of standard features.  Open concept interiors offer 9' ceilings on the main floor, breakfast bars (as per plan), 41” kitchen cabinetry, unique windows and circular staircases. The homes feature soaring two-storey foyers, master suite balconies, and cathedral ceilings in the kitchen, great room and bedrooms.  Brick and stone exteriors, with vaulted covered porches and double garages add to the elegance of the homes.  Steel garage doors, Napoleon gas fireplaces and plush 40 oz. carpeting are also standard on all of the homes.
            The Sienna is a 1,442 square foot bungalow design.  With two bedrooms and a double car garage, this home is perfect for empty nesters!  The large kitchen includes an island with a flush breakfast bar, a pantry and a bright breakfast area.  It opens to the great room, which features a gas fireplace.  The master bedroom has a walk-in closet and private ensuite with a linen closet.
The Copperfield is a 2,096 square foot, three bedroom design that features a two car garage.  The gourmet kitchen includes an island with a flush breakfast bar, a chef’s desk and two pantries.  It is open to both the dining room and the bright, sunken family room, which has a gas fireplace and a cathedral ceiling.  The master bedroom includes a spacious walk-in closet and a private ensuite with a separate shower and soaker tub.  The second bedroom has a cathedral ceiling, and the second floor also features a laundry area and three-piece bathroom.

City Homes Opens Four Models at Conlin Village

Oshawa, your wait is over! City Homes has just opened four new models at its Conlin Village community. This new neighbourhood focuses on ease of living, in a great area of the city.

These stunning designs feature quality clay brick exteriors, combining architectural accents and heritage colours for an appealing streetscape. Prices start in the $190’s and include four appliances.

These homes have been designed with the entertainer in mind. The fabulous kitchen is at the heart of the home and features a functional layout to appeal to the most discerning chef. With lots of counter space and the option of an extended breakfast bar, gourmet meals are sure to be served in the adjoining eating area. Half walls define the great room, with bright windows and access to the rear yard. Upstairs, the master bedroom features double closets, and two additional bedrooms share the main bathroom. The main floor is open to future expansion as your priorities in life change. Each home has a private drive, garage and garden. Homes feature an optional second-floor laundry, powder rooms and almost all have ensuites. An optional finished walkout package provides a deck and a walkout from the basement.

With no grass to cut or snow to shovel, living in Conlin Village gives you more time to do the things you want to do. A limited number of inventory homes will be available for occupancy this spring, and a new phase, being released this month, has closing dates in the fall and in early 2008.
